Abstract:
A watching brief was carried out during the construction of a new extension. When the site was visited most of the foundation trenches for the new extension had already been excavated. The trenches appeared to have caused little damage to archaeological deposits although it was impossible to examine trench sections in detail due to their depth and instability. The pottery found consisted of three pieces of grey ware and a single sherd of Severn Valley ware. These sherds were left with the owners of the house. [Au(abr)]
